原文:pprof命令總結

啟用pprof分析 獲取診斷報告進行分析 直接訪問 localhost: debug pprof 可以看到能獲取到的診斷報告 診斷報告類型 備注 allocs 內存分配采樣 block 導致阻塞的的同步語句堆棧信息, 但需要使用runtime.SetBlockProfileRate 開啟 cmdline 進程啟動的命令行參數 goroutine 當前所有goroutine的堆棧信息 heap 當前 ...

2021-04-11 20:07 0 263 推薦指數:

查看詳情

Pprof

安裝 安裝go-torch 安裝FlameGraph 安裝graphviz 使用pprof ab壓測 安裝apache 使用ab命令 基本使用 pprof使用 監聽 ...

Sun Mar 15 21:53:00 CST 2020 0 2551
golang pprof

一:背景 當正在運行的golang程序消耗預期之外的內存和時間,我們這個時候就需要去弄明白,到底是是我們的代碼哪個地方消耗了這些內存及相應時間。但此時編譯好的golang程序對我們而言是黑盒,如果去分析具體的內存及時間使用情況?這個時候我們可以去了解和使用pprof來分析golang進程的內存 ...

Wed Dec 15 22:58:00 CST 2021 0 809
golang pprof 內存分析

use pprof to get application memory useage add code in your main funciton build and compile you application. let application run ...

Thu Jan 11 02:45:00 CST 2018 0 2720
golang 性能測試pprof

植入: 在main包中 import _ "net/http/pprof" 在main函數中添加 go func() { log.Println(http.ListenAndServe("0.0.0.0:6060", nil ...

Mon Sep 18 18:27:00 CST 2017 0 2201
golang 性能剖析pprof

作為一個golang coder,使用golang編寫代碼是基本的要求。 能夠寫出代碼,並能夠熟悉程序執行過程中各方面的性能指標,則是更上一層樓。 如果在程序出現性能問題的時候,可以快速定位和解決問題,那么寫起代碼來,會更加自信。 本文介紹的pprof,是golang 自帶性能剖析工具 ...

Sun Sep 22 00:26:00 CST 2019 0 420
Golang pprof詳解

go的pprof包 go中有pprof包來做代碼的性能監控,在兩個地方有包: net/http/pprof runtime/pprof 其實net/http/pprof中只是使用runtime/pprof包來進行封裝了一下,並在http端口上暴露出來. 本篇只講如何在web上查看 ...

Thu Aug 30 00:20:00 CST 2018 0 3261
Go pprof和火焰圖

Profiling 在計算機性能調試領域里,profiling 就是對應用的畫像,這里畫像就是應用使用 CPU 和內存的情況。也就是說應用使用了多少 CPU 資源?都是哪些部分在使用?每個函數使用的 ...

Mon Feb 18 04:21:00 CST 2019 0 3769
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M